To log in to the TI-Nspire™ Navigator™ network
1.
If you have not already done so, begin the class session on your
computer.
computer.
2.
Make sure the TI-Nspire™ handheld is ready for login. (The
icon
is blinking.)
3.
To log in, do one of the following:
–
From the home screen of your TI-Nspire™ handheld, select
5:Settings & Status > 5:Login.
–
From a screen other than the home screen, press
~
> 8:Login
.
4.
Type your username and password. (Press
e
to move to the next
field.)
5.
Select
Login
.
The Login Successful screen displays.
